About Royal Melbourne Institute of Technology (RMIT) - Training

RMIT Training is a company, owned by RMIT University, based in Melbourne, Australia. RMIT Training provides face-to-face and online education solutions to students, academics and professionals around the world. RMIT Training delivers Foundation Studies and English for Academic Purposes pathway courses that enable students to articulate into university programs. 

RMIT is one of Australia's original tertiary institutions and has an international reputation for excellence in education, research, and engagement with industry and community. RMIT was established in 1887 as the Working Men’s College with the aim of bringing education to the working people of Melbourne. Today, RMIT is a global university of technology, design and enterprise and a world leader in Art and Design; Architecture; Education; Engineering; Development; Computer Science and Information Systems; Business and Management; and Communication and Media Studies. Why RMIT Training:

  • Academic Support: Academic Support offers 1-on-1 coaching, peer-mentoring and, weekly workshops and shares helpful resources to help students achieve their study goals.  RMIT Training provides direct admission to university upon successful completion of relevant pathway courses.
  • Student Wellness: Student Wellbeing is a safe space for RMIT students to get advice and support about mental health, managing stress and dealing with problems inside and outside of the classroom.
  • Activities and Events: Life at RMIT Training extends far beyond the classroom. Community and connection are important for a rich and fulfilling student experience. Students can join activities to socialise, make new friends, practise English and build meaningful connections with fellow students.
